On Tue, Jun 12, 2007 at 10:25:38AM -0600, Andrew Falanga wrote: > > > > You don't need cvsup-without-gui anymore. A rewrite in C called csup is > > part of the base system in 6.2. > > > > This should be fixed in the handbook, as it still references cvsup. > > > > Roland > > Thank you for this. I was not aware. However, would it still not > behoove me to find out what is going on, if there really is a problem? > I'm looking to install WebGUI on this system which requires MySQL and > ImageMagick (both of which are in the ports). Wouldn't a compilation > of other program produce similar results?
If the compiler (cc) dies with a 'fatal signal 11', you could have a memory problem.
